Statement Regarding Ahern Field/Play Areas Project
After careful consideration of community input, City Council feedback, and the project's overall goals, we have decided not to install a synthetic turf field or the athletic lighting, which was included to support additional permitted use of the space.
Red Line Closure 2026
Red Line service will be suspended between Alewife and Park Street for 10 consecutive days this July. Free and accessible shuttle buses will replace and make all stops between Alewife and Park Street.
CYP Atlanta Trip
This spring, fifteen Cambridge teens traveled to Atlanta to explore Black history, celebrate Black joy, and discover future opportunities. The trip was part of Cambridge Youth Programs’ out-of-state travel program, which invites recognized leaders in CYP’s teen programs on trips to tour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s).
